The Company
Poderation is Podcasts for Nerds – a niche podcast network focusing on representing nerdy interests of all stripes. Operating primarily with media and gaming podcasts, but with extensions into other related areas, our goal is to create a space where nerdy podcasts can reside, grow and thrive supporting each other. We’re currently more than 20 podcasts strong, and looking to expand out network to new areas of the varied worlds of nerdy media.
The Role
The Business Development Assistant will primarily be responsible for identifying, contacting and eventually negotiating with podcasts in Poderation’s niche(s) to bring them on as clients of the business’ advertising and podcast management network. This is a fully-remote role, initially covering primarily lead generation and initial contact stages of the Business Development process, but eventually expanding to cover all aspects of the client engagement process. Initially working with the Founder/Managing Director as you get up to speed, but ultimately operating on your own, you’ll need an independent mindset with an eye for the unusual to succeed, combined with a willingness to shepherd a sales process from initial research all the way through to contract signatures.
As a young business, this role would be ideal for someone looking for an entry into business development and sales in the media sector who’d like to shape a role with a start-up as it grows. The role would initially comprise roughly 35 hours per month of work, with a competitive base salary and bonuses directly tied to the size and performance of shows that you bring onto the network.
